Default Black smoke, No power, No codes D5 E3 163 215k xc70

Hi.

Got this gremlin in my D5 120kW 163bhp Euro3 auto 215k miles (xc70) where there are black smoke, no power, no codes and wont rev past 2500rpm also has very noticable ticking noise. Struggle to start when warm but ok when cold. Happened after i hit speed bump (not sure if relevant or not) Also had camshaft error when this first happened.


Troubleshooting done so far are as follows:

1. New camshaft sensor (cleared the code)
2. MAF readings within values (49-57 kg/h)
3. Fuel rail pressure within values
4. New fuel filter
5. Last x3 tanks had Shell premium diesel
6. Anything EGR related been eliminated by Vdash D5T5 Stage 1 EGR OFF
7. New MAP sensor
8. Intercooler smoke pressure tested no leaks
9. Intake smoke pressure tested no leaks
10. Exhaust removed from Turbo hot side to eliminate cat blockage (cat clean)
11. Injector leak back test between 6ml-10ml on warm engine
12. Injectors when disconnected engine splutters/dies (which indicates to me electromagnet switch works
13. Injector tips stripped and cleaned in sonic bath (spray pattern smooth)
14. Injectors reseated
15. Cylinder compression 350psi
16. Vacuum system new lines also new VNT
17. Turbo actuator moves when vacuum applied also moves freely when pushed by hand
18. Engine mounts hold vacuum
19. Timing not jumped
20. Engine loom wiring sleeves are cracked in multiple places especially above intake cover but strands have no damage.
21. Air mass/stroke 490mg/s
22. Air intake clear of obstructions of any kind, no blockages
23. Turbo cartrige spins freely, no exessive movement or any other damage seen
24. No misfire, idles ok

Black smoke tells me overfueling/bad air to fuel mix

Could ticking noise be collapsed lifters or something?!

Just to note, when MAF is disconnected behaviour on engine does not change apart from triggering error code. Replaced with spare MAF unit and it reads same values in Vida also checked voltage in plug and it has 12v #1 pin and 5v#4 pin as per Vida.

When revved (pedal burried in floorboards) for few seconds it triggers Engine Service Required message which on Vida comes up as MAF negative drift which is because it struggles to get air?!

I'm out of my comfort zone on this one.

I can get 120k engine cheap so do i just swap it out?!

That's a lot of work already done there, I must change commend you.

Perhaps verify that the hose at the turbo compressor inlet is not collapsing (and hence choking the air supply) when the engine is loaded?
